4194:
Vassal - only the mouse pointer counts

Pierre: the trick is not to get confused by the actual position of  
the counter when you move it. When you start dragging the counter  
there is a very noticeable offset from the position of the mouse  
pointer. Ignore where the counter seems to be then: point the mouse  
to the center of the hex you want to move to and release the button.  
The counter will appear (jump to) in the correct hex. Since I  
realized this I hadn't any movement problems.

4199:
VASSAL Offset

Also, if you have a Mac, the VASSAL Offset is much worse. It is fixed  
in the Java 1.6 preview available on the Apple website
